WebApr 11, 2024 · Pakisuyo po ang baso. Please pass the glass. Adding the word “po” makes the statement sound much more polite and is perfect when you are speaking with someone who is older than you. Pasuyo nga ng libro. Please pass the book. The adverb “nga” is also untranslatable but it is basically used to add emphasis.
